URL: https://www.opennet.ru/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ID1
Нить номер: 87178
[ Назад ]

Исходное сообщение
"DHCPD не может выдать адрес для iPhone"

Отправлено sv_igor , 07-Ноя-09 05:25 
Здравствуйте. Поставил ASP-Linux 14 Corelia.
Запущен дхцп сервер. для виндовых машин выдает айпишники нормально, но для моего iphone - не хочет, хотя в логах вот что пишется:

Nov  7 06:11:59 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:11:59 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:00 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:00 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:01 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:01 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:03 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:03 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:05 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:05 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:10 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:10 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:18 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:18 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:20 server avahi-daemon[5829]: Invalid query packet.
Nov  7 06:12:20 server avahi-daemon[5829]: Invalid query packet.
Nov  7 06:12:20 server avahi-daemon[5829]: Invalid query packet.
Nov  7 06:12:27 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:27 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:36 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:36 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:45 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:45 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:54 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:12:54 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0
Nov  7 06:13:02 server dhcpd: DHCPDISCOVER from 00:26:08:9e:e6:25 via eth0
Nov  7 06:13:02 server dhcpd: DHCPOFFER on 192.168.0.19 to 00:26:08:9e:e6:25 via eth0


по ходу он пытается выдать адрес но айфон не может его принять. avahi пробовал отключать - ноль эффекта, хотя я незнаю что это такое.

На предыдущем asp-linux 10 все отлично работало с тем же конфигом. вот сообственно и он:

# dhcpd.conf
#
# Configuration file for ISC dhcpd (see 'man dhcpd.conf')
#
server-identifier server.vuz.net;
ddns-updates off;
ddns-update-style none;
authoritative;

subnet 192.168.100.0 netmask 255.255.255.0 {
}


subnet 192.168.0.0 netmask 255.255.255.0 {
        range 192.168.0.30 192.168.0.254;
        default-lease-time 72000;
        max-lease-time 144000;
        get-lease-hostnames true;
        option netbios-name-servers 192.168.0.1;
        option netbios-dd-server 192.168.0.1;
        option netbios-node-type 8;
        option interface-mtu 1500;
        option subnet-mask 255.255.255.0;
        option broadcast-address 192.168.0.255;
        option domain-name-servers 192.168.100.1;
        option domain-name "vuz.net";
        option time-offset 39600;
        option ip-forwarding on;
        option routers 192.168.0.1;
}
host iPhone {
            hardware ethernet 00:26:08:9e:e6:25;
            fixed-address 192.168.0.19;
            }

в чем может быть собственно проблема?


Содержание

Сообщения в этом обсуждении
"DHCPD не может выдать адрес для iPhone"
Отправлено ALex_hha , 07-Ноя-09 16:14 
Что то не понял прикола, у тебя

range 192.168.0.30 192.168.0.254;

но при этом ты выдаешь 192.168.0.19 адрес не из диапазона. Какой в этом глубокий смысл?

> avahi пробовал отключать - ноль эффекта, хотя я незнаю что это такое.

а зачем тогда отключал?! :)


"DHCPD не может выдать адрес для iPhone"
Отправлено Vladimir , 07-Ноя-09 16:57 
>[оверквотинг удален]
>
>range 192.168.0.30 192.168.0.254;
>
>но при этом ты выдаешь 192.168.0.19 адрес не из диапазона. Какой в
>этом глубокий смысл?
>
>> avahi пробовал отключать - ноль эффекта, хотя я незнаю что это такое.
>
>а зачем тогда отключал?! :)
>> range 192.168.0.30 192.168.0.254;

  Это для динамических клиентов, те кому выдается ip по mac-у не должны входить в пул адресов.
  


"DHCPD не может выдать адрес для iPhone"
Отправлено sv_igor , 08-Ноя-09 16:21 
>[оверквотинг удален]
>>этом глубокий смысл?
>>
>>> avahi пробовал отключать - ноль эффекта, хотя я незнаю что это такое.
>>
>>а зачем тогда отключал?! :)
>>> range 192.168.0.30 192.168.0.254;
>
>  Это для динамических клиентов, те кому выдается ip по mac-у
>не должны входить в пул адресов.
>

ну в принципе ты прав

2Alex_hha да у меня и было с 2 по 254 адрес....та же фигня
убирал чтобы проверить методом тыка)

Ребятки вообщем я решил проблему. дафига опций убрал и все заработало....видимо айфон одну из некоторых опциий схавать не мог...вообщем щас конфиг такой:
authoritative;
default-lease-time 600;
max-lease-time 7200;
log-facility local7;
subnet 192.168.0.0 netmask 255.255.255.0 {
        range 192.168.0.30 192.168.0.254;
        option netbios-name-servers 192.168.0.1;
        option domain-name-servers 192.168.100.1;
        option domain-name "vuz.net";
        option routers 192.168.0.1;
}